[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of oil mist recovery equipment, in particular to an oil mist recovery absorption tower heat tracing system. BACKGROUND

[0002] In the process of aluminum foil rolling, deformation heat is generated due to metal deformation, and process requires the use of rolling oil as lubricating coolant to take away heat and lubricate reasonably. Due to the effect of deformation heat, part of the rolling oil is atomized to form oil droplets with different particle sizes suspended above the rolling mill, which is commonly known as rolling oil mist. In engineering, oil droplets larger than 5 microns are called liquid oil mist, and oil droplets smaller than 5 microns are called gaseous oil mist. Oil mist will have a serious impact on the environment and human health, so it is very important to collect and recycle oil mist during production.

[0003] The absorption process of oil mist requires the use of an absorption tower, and the absorption tower will have the following problems when used in winter: The absorption tower stores washing oil (i.e. absorbent), and the washing oil will solidify and cannot be started after a period of use due to the mixing of high-viscosity lubricating oil (i.e. absorbed oil mist). Therefore, an oil mist recovery absorption tower heat tracing system is proposed to solve the above technical problems. CONTENT OF THE INVENTION

[0028] One preferred embodiment of the present application is shown in Figures 1 to 8 An oil mist recovery absorption tower heat tracing system, comprising an absorption tower body 1, a heating assembly 3, a stirring assembly 6, and a driving mechanism 5, the heating assembly 3 is installed inside the lower end of the absorption tower body 1, the stirring assembly 6 is movably arranged at the lower end of the side of the absorption tower body 1, and the driving mechanism 5 is installed on the side of the absorption tower body 1 and connected and matched with the stirring assembly 6.

[0029] It can be understood that when the oil in the absorption tower body 1 is condensed in winter, the heating assembly 3 and the driving mechanism 5 are started, the heating assembly 3 can melt the oil, and the driving mechanism 5 can drive the stirring assembly 6 to stir and mix the oil, thereby accelerating the melting process of the oil. After heating is completed, the driving mechanism 5 can retract the stirring assembly 6 at the side of the absorption tower body 1, which reduces the occupied space in the absorption tower body 1 and protects the stirring assembly 6 to improve the service life.

[0030] In one embodiment of the present application, as shown in Figure 3 and Figure 4 , the lower end of the side of the absorption tower body 1 is connected and mounted with the shell 2, the stirring assembly 6 is movably arranged in the shell 2, the driving mechanism 5 includes a moving device 8 and a driving device 7, the moving device 8 is mounted in the shell 2 and connected with the stirring assembly 6, and the driving device 7 is mounted in the shell 2 and has a one-way transmission connection with the stirring assembly 6 and the moving device 8.

[0031] It can be understood that when the driving device 7 performs the first action, the driving device 7 can drive the stirring assembly 6 to act, thereby stirring the oil in the absorption tower body 1. When the driving device 7 performs the second action, the driving device 7 can drive the moving device 8 to extend or retract the stirring assembly 6 into the shell 2. It should be understood that when the stirring assembly 6 extends out of the shell 2, it enters the absorption tower body 1, and when the stirring assembly 6 retracts into the shell 2, it separates from the absorption tower body 1.

[0032] Further, in order to prevent the oil in the absorption tower body 1 from flowing back into the shell 2, as shown in Figure 7 and Figure 8 , the shell 2 can be installed upwardly inclined, and the mounting point of the shell 2 is located above the oil level, so that under the action of gravity, the oil will not be stored in the shell 2.

[0033] Further description of the above embodiment: as shown in Figure 4 , the moving device 8 includes a reciprocating screw rod 801 and a sliding block 802, the reciprocating screw rod 801 is rotatably mounted in the shell 2 and has an end connected with the driving device 7, the sliding block 802 is slidably arranged in the shell 2 and connected with the stirring assembly 6, and the sliding block 802 cooperates with the reciprocating screw rod 801. It can be understood that when the driving device 7 performs the second action, the reciprocating screw rod 801 is driven to rotate, the reciprocating screw rod 801 acts on the sliding block 802, thereby driving the sliding block 802 to move the stirring assembly 6 to extend or retract the stirring assembly 6.

[0034] As shown in Figure 5 and Figure 6As shown, the stirring assembly 6 comprises a stirring shaft 601, stirring blades 603 and a sleeve 602, the stirring shaft 601 is rotatably installed on the sliding block 802 and the bottom end is installed with the stirring blades 603, the sleeve 602 is rotatably installed outside the shell 2 and connected with the driving device 7, the sleeve 602 is sleeved outside the stirring shaft 601 and connected with the stirring shaft 601 through the spline, that is, the stirring shaft 601 can be axially adjusted relative to the sleeve 602 under the action of the spline, and the sleeve 602 can drive the stirring shaft 601 to rotate under the action of the spline. Therefore, it can be understood that the driving device 7 can drive the sleeve 602 to rotate through the first action, and the sleeve 602 can drive the stirring shaft 601 to rotate to perform the stirring mixing operation.

[0035] In this embodiment, as shown in Figure 5 and Figure 6 The driving device 7 comprises a motor 701, a first transmission assembly 702 and a second transmission assembly 703, the motor 701 is installed outside the shell 2, the input ends of the first transmission assembly 702 and the second transmission assembly 703 are one-way transmission connected with the output end of the motor 701, and the output ends of the first transmission assembly 702 and the second transmission assembly 703 are connected with the sleeve 602 and the reciprocating screw rod 801 respectively.

[0036] It can be understood that when the first action is performed, we can set the forward rotation of the motor 701, the motor 701 can drive the stirring shaft 601 to rotate through the first transmission assembly 702, and at this time the second transmission assembly 703 is in disengaged state. Similarly, when the second action is performed, that is, the reverse rotation of the motor 701, the motor 701 can drive the reciprocating screw rod 801 to rotate through the second transmission assembly 703, and at this time the first transmission assembly 702 is in disengaged state.

[0037] As a further description of the above embodiment, the specific structure of the first transmission assembly 702 and the second transmission assembly 703 is not limited in this application, and a specific embodiment is provided below for reference:

[0038] The first transmission assembly 702 comprises a pulley one 7021, a pulley two 7022 and a synchronous belt one 7023, the pulley one 7021 is sleeved and installed on the sleeve 602, the pulley two 7022 is installed on the output end of the motor 701 through the one-way bearing 10, and the synchronous belt one 7023 is sleeved and installed on the pulley one 7021 and the pulley two 7022. The second transmission assembly 703 comprises a pulley three 7031, a pulley four 7032 and a synchronous belt two 7033, the pulley three 7031 is sleeved and installed on the reciprocating screw rod 801, and the pulley four 7032 is installed on the output end of the motor 701 through the one-way bearing 10.

[0039] It can be understood that when the motor 701 is rotating in the first action, the one-way bearing 10 on the pulley two 7022 is in the biting state, and then through the cooperation between the synchronous belt one 7023 and the pulley one 7021, the sleeve 602 and the stirring shaft 601 can be driven to rotate. At this time, the one-way bearing 10 on the pulley four 7032 is in the free state, that is, the second transmission assembly 703 is in the disengaged state, so that the reciprocating lead screw 801 remains stationary.

[0040] When the motor 701 performs the second action, the one-way bearing 10 on the pulley four 7032 is in the biting state, and then through the cooperation between the synchronous belt two 7033 and the pulley three 7031, the reciprocating lead screw 801 can be driven to rotate. At this time, the one-way bearing 10 on the pulley two 7022 is in the free state, that is, the first transmission assembly 702 is in the disengaged state, so that the stirring shaft 601 remains stationary.

[0041] It should be known that since the shell 2 is connected and installed on the side of the absorption tower body 1, when the stirring assembly 6 is not used and is retracted in the shell 2, at this time the oil mist in the absorption tower body 1 will also enter the shell 2, thereby affecting the parts in the shell 2.

[0042] Therefore, in order to solve the above technical problems, in one embodiment of the present application, as shown in Figure 4 The bottom end of the stirring shaft 601 extends and rotates to install a piston 9. It can be understood that when the stirring assembly 6 is retracted and rises, after the stirring assembly 6 rises to the limit position, at this time the piston 9 just blocks at the bottom end of the shell 2, and at this time the piston 9 and the inner side of the absorption tower body 1 are tangent, that is, the piston 9 does not protrude from the inner side of the absorption tower body 1, and it just fits the missing part of the inner side of the absorption tower body 1, as shown in Figure 7 .

[0043] Specifically, as shown in Figure 4 When the stirring assembly 6 is retracted, the piston 9 can form a sealed cavity between the inside of the shell 2, thereby isolating the stirring assembly 6 from the tower body, and an oil outlet 4 is provided at the lower end of the outside of the shell 2, which is in communication with the sealed cavity. The oil outlet 4 includes an oil outlet pipe and an end cap, the oil outlet pipe is in communication with the sealed cavity, and the end cap can be threadedly connected to the bottom end of the oil outlet pipe.

[0044] Understandably, when the stirring assembly 6 extends into the absorption tower body 1, oil will adhere to the stirring shaft 601, stirring blades 603, and piston 9. When the stirring assembly 6 retracts into the shell 2, this adhered oil will be carried into the sealed cavity. Over time, the oil is prone to deterioration, thus affecting the internal environment of the shell 2. By providing the oil outlet 4, the internal oil will accumulate in the oil outlet pipe under gravity. Then, by opening the end cap, the internal oil can be discharged, effectively avoiding the deterioration problem caused by the long-term accumulation of oil in the sealed cavity. In addition, the oil outlet 4 can also serve as a cleaning port, i.e., cleaning can be performed by injecting cleaning fluid into the shell 2.

[0045] In this embodiment, as Figure 2 As shown, heating component 3 is a coil. During heating, a heat transfer medium (such as heat transfer oil or steam) is injected into the coil, and then the oil in the absorption tower 1 is indirectly heated through the coil. This can effectively solve the shutdown problem caused by the solidification of the wash oil, and also avoid the safety hazards caused by installing heat tracing (such as electric heating wire or electric heating plate).

[0046] The working principle of this utility model is as follows:

[0047] When it is necessary to melt the oil inside the tower, heat transfer oil can be introduced into the coil, thereby melting the oil inside the tower through heat transfer. To improve the uniformity and efficiency of oil heating, a stirring component 6 can be used to stir and mix the oil. Initially, the stirring component 6 is as follows... Figure 7 As shown, it contracts and is located inside the housing 2. First, the motor 701 is started to perform the second action (reverse rotation), which then drives the reciprocating screw 801 to rotate through the second transmission assembly 703. The reciprocating screw 801 acts on the slider 802, which in turn causes the slider 802 to drive the stirring assembly 6 to move downward to its limit position, as shown. Figure 8 As shown. At this time, the motor 701 performs the first action (forward rotation), which in turn drives the stirring shaft 601 to rotate through the first transmission component 702. The stirring blades 603 then mix and stir the oil, achieving rapid heating and melting of the oil. Finally, the stirring component 6 retracts, that is, the motor 701 is restarted in reverse, and under the action of the reciprocating screw 801, the stirring component 6 moves upward into the housing 2, so that the stirring component 6 returns to its initial state.
